A Savannah, Georgia, native, Hattie Saussy was known as a portraitist and traveled throughout the Southeast to paint regional landscapes. In Woman in Kimono, Saussy deviates from these subjects to create a genre scene influenced by the Japonism movement popular at the turn of the century. Although a watercolor, the image is reminiscent of Japanese wood block prints featuring flat areas of broad color, little to no shading, and a slightly off center composition.
